Positive Solutions for a Class of Third-Order Three-Point Boundary Value Problem
We investigate the problem of existence of positive solutions for the nonlinear third-order three-point boundary value problem u‴(t)+λa(t)f(u(t))=0, 0<t<1, u(0)=u′(0)=0, u″(1)=∝u″(η), where λ is a positive parameter, ∝∈(0,1), η∈(0,1), f:(0,∞)→(0,∞), a:(0,1)→(0,∞) are continuous. Using a specia...
